    What type of acid is used in a battery?

    Battery Acid: This is sulfuric acid with a concentration of 29-32% or 4.2-5.0 mol/L, commonly found in lead-acid batteries. Chamber Acid or Fertilizer Acid: Sulfuric acid at a concentration of 62-70% or 9.2-11.5 mol/L, produced using the lead chamber process.

    What is a lithium iron phosphate battery (LiFePO4)?

    Lithium iron phosphate batteries (LiFePO4) are a type of battery with a life span 10 times longer than that of traditional lead-acid batteries. This results in fewer costs per kilowatt-hour, as the need for battery changes is dramatically reduced. LiFePO4 batteries have this advantage over lead acid batteries.

    How efficient are lithium ion batteries?

    Lithium-ion batteries have an efficiency of 95 percent or more, meaning that 95 percent or more of the energy stored in a lithium-ion battery is actually able to be used. Sealed Lead Acid batteries, on the other hand, see efficiencies closer to 80 to 85 percent.

    What are the causes of lead-acid battery fire

    A lead acid battery can explode from sparks caused by static electricity, flames, or welding during charging. Charging produces hydrogen gas, which is highly flammable.


    FAQs about What are the causes of lead-acid battery fire

    What causes a lead-acid battery explosion?

    The primary causes of lead-acid battery explosions include overcharging, blocked vent holes, and the accumulation of flammable gases. Understanding these risks is crucial for safe usage. Overcharging: One of the most common causes of lead-acid battery explosions is overcharging.

    What is a vented lead acid battery?

    Vented lead acid: This group of batteries is “open” and allows gas to escape without any positive pressure building up in the cells. This type can be topped up, thus they present tolerance to high temperatures and over-charging. The free electrolyte is also responsible for the facilitation of the battery's cooling.

    Which preheating method is best for EV batteries?

    Due to low thermal conductivity and high space requirement, air preheating is only suitable for early generation EVs with low energy density batteries. At the moment, liquid preheating is the most commonly used method since it has demonstrated good preheating performance and consistent temperature distribution.

    What are the different types of battery preheat technology?

    The first category is self-heating technology, which uses the battery's energy to preheat the battery. The second category is current excitation technology, which usually requires an applied current excitation and generates heat through the internal impedance and thus preheats the battery.

    What is battery fluid cold and hot

    Cold temperatures reduce the battery's capacity to store and deliver energy. For every 10°C drop in temperature, capacity can decrease by around 20%! Cold weather increases internal resistance, hindering current flow, which results in reduced power output and slower charging/discharging rates.
